Pros

- As the Headline says, there's always new things to work on at Photomath. Though most of the company is based in Zagrab, Croatia, there is a group of employees that is based out of the Bay Area, and this part of the company feels very start-upish (which I love) - I really feel like my work is making an impact on the product that we're giving to our end-users - Everyone is an absolute pleasure to work with. I've been here for over a year and have not once had any sort of work-place passive-aggresiveness that one can encounter - Their vacation policy is very generous, and you can tell that management really does want people to use it, since it's apparent in all facets of the company that people here appreciate a good work-life balance

Cons

- As mentioned before, a lot of the company is based in Croatia, so depending on the role you're in, you might have to take several meetings per week with other employees with a 9-hour time difference, which can give you either early morning or late-night meetings
